Commit Graph

63 Commits (71b26adb9b737717ebd79a1a513bebe52e787e8b)

Author SHA1 Message Date
Mike Fährmann 3d8777fbc1
move user agent string to util.py
2 years ago
Mike Fährmann cbe4769246
[danbooru] use gallery-dl UA (#3665)
2 years ago
Mike Fährmann bbf0911a46
[e621] implement 'notes' and 'pools' metadata extraction
2 years ago
Mike Fährmann 925b467496
split e621 from danbooru module (#3425)
2 years ago
Mike Fährmann c87bd1a752
[danbooru] extend 'metadata' option
2 years ago
blankie f82ee93676
[danbooru] extract uploader metadata (if metadata is set)
2 years ago
ClosedPort22 dd4a4a3fa6
[e621] softcode the pagination threshold
2 years ago
ClosedPort22 9faa4ed738
[e621] refactor pagination control
2 years ago
ClosedPort22 d0ad6d0e67
[e621] implement manual pagination mode
2 years ago
Mike Fährmann e99ce99284
[danbooru] remove stray 'print()'
2 years ago
Mike Fährmann 4e26bf98f5
[aibooru] support 'safe' subdomain (#3110)
2 years ago
thatfuckingbird 062ef238a6
add support for aibooru (using danbooru extractor) (#3075)
2 years ago
Mike Fährmann d0d4ce1a13
[danbooru] fix ugoira metadata extraction (#3056)
2 years ago
Mike Fährmann f362d4a3c7
[e621] fix 'popular' extraction
2 years ago
Mike Fährmann c6a9bab019
update extractor test results
2 years ago
Mike Fährmann 3f02e483c6
[e621] fix applying request_interval_min (#2533)
2 years ago
Mike Fährmann 563bd0ecf4
[danbooru] inherit from BaseExtractor
3 years ago
Mike Fährmann cadfad4eea
[danbooru] add 'external' option (closes #1747)
3 years ago
Mike Fährmann 221015e586
[downloader:http] disable filename extension changes for ugoira
3 years ago
thatfuckingbird 224b883ff4
[danbooru] add option for extended metadata extraction (#1458)
3 years ago
Mike Fährmann d781e6ac44
[e621] return pool posts in order (closes #1195)
4 years ago
Mike Fährmann e7d446a8f7
[danbooru] slight code refactoring
4 years ago
Mike Fährmann 1e3dd7330e
merge SharedConfigMixin functionality into Extractor
4 years ago
Mike Fährmann 2626629117
[danbooru] handle posts without 'id' (fixes #1004)
4 years ago
Mike Fährmann e19f665a44
[danbooru] change default for 'ugoira' to 'false'
4 years ago
Mike Fährmann ad2efa8509
[e621] derive from Danbooru extractors (#651)
5 years ago
Mike Fährmann 5bcc7184c9
[danbooru][e621] increase page limits
5 years ago
Mike Fährmann f117e32910
[danbooru] restore 'popular' functionality
5 years ago
Mike Fährmann 86c00f9e66
[danbooru] move extractor logic from booru.py
5 years ago
Mike Fährmann f02a768b5c
[danbooru] add 'ugoira' option (#406)
5 years ago
Mike Fährmann 6284731107
simplify extractor constants
6 years ago
Mike Fährmann 1e4d351ad3
[danbooru] add authentication support (closes #151)
6 years ago
Mike Fährmann e1d306cc48
update unit test results
6 years ago
Mike Fährmann 6ac403c5d3
add postprocessor config example
6 years ago
Mike Fährmann 3905474805
[booru] call update_page() with correct dict (closes #82)
7 years ago
Mike Fährmann 974e73bdbb
[booru] smaller code adjustments
7 years ago
Mike Fährmann 1219ebb7f5
[danbooru] use alternate subdomains; support safebooru
7 years ago
Mike Fährmann 9e8a84ab6c
[booru] rewrite using Mixin classes (#59)
7 years ago
Mike Fährmann 289d6b65d2
[danbooru] extend and improve URL regex
7 years ago
Mike Fährmann 65997d835b
replace popular/ranking tests with older ones
7 years ago
Mike Fährmann 07214f4007
[booru] place subcategories into base classes
7 years ago
Mike Fährmann 47bcf53ec1
implement support for additional unit test result types
7 years ago
Mike Fährmann 18e6ed1c7e
[booru] add extractors for "Popular" images
7 years ago
Mike Fährmann c921b4f32a
code cleanup and fixing tests
7 years ago
Mike Fährmann cf79a47b59
update unit tests
8 years ago
Mike Fährmann ed94d9b92d
fix/improve various things
8 years ago
Mike Fährmann 94e10f249a
code adjustments according to pep8 nr2
8 years ago
Mike Fährmann d7e168799d
consistent extractor naming scheme + docstrings
8 years ago
Mike Fährmann 6f7d42b974
update tests
8 years ago
Mike Fährmann 616e0aedd6
update booru testdata
9 years ago